Baptisia australis Baptisia australis 

 ca$ 3.95  Buy Now 
Erect perennial in the family Leguminosae with palmate green leaves that bears dark blue flowers in early summer, followed by black seed pods. Great for flower arrangements. Height 5 feet; spread 2 feet. 
Begonia grandis var. alba Begonia grandis var. alba 

 ca$ 4.50  Buy Now 
This bulbous begonia has ovate, olive-green leaves that are red beneath and bears pendent cymes of fragrant pinkish-white flowers in summer. Height 24 inches; spread 18 inches. 
Camassia cusickii Camassia cusickii 

 ca$ 4.35  Buy Now 
This bulb produces pale to steel blue flowers in late spring on flower spikes up to almost a meter in height above wavy edged glaucous-green leaves. Height 24-36 inches.

Camassia leichtlinii subsp suksdorfii Camassia leichtlinii subsp suksdorfii 

 ca$ 4.15  Buy Now 
Bulbous perennial with linear leaves 20-60 cm long. In late spring, bears terminal racemes 10-30 cm long of star-shaped, purple flowers on leafless stems. Grow in a border or wild flower meadow or in a container. 
Camassia quamash Camassia quamash 

 ca$ 4.25  Buy Now 
This bulbous perennial is smaller than the other Camassias, but is nonetheless a very desirable and attractive plant to grow in your garden. Height 8-32 inches. When given sufficient moisture and a suitable location, this species is able to naturalize easily. 
Campanula lactiflora Campanula lactiflora 

 ca$ 3.45  Buy Now 
This tall species of Campanula, growing to 2 meters (6ft) in height, covers itself in masses of milky white or pale mauve blooms in early summer, making a spectacular show for traditional border plantings, or for a cottage garden. 
Campanula latifolia Campanula latifolia 

 ca$ 3.45  Buy Now 
This vigorous, upright perennial bears tubular-bell-shaped flowers in shades of blue, violet or white from axils of the upper leaves in summer. Height to 4 feet; spread 2 feet. 
Campanula persicifolia Campanula persicifolia 

 ca$ 3.45  Buy Now 
This rosette-forming perennial has lance-shaped basal evergreen leaves and in early to mid-summer bears racemes of two to three bell-shaped lilac-blue to white flowers on slender stems. Height to 3 feet;spread 12 inches. Suits a mixed or herbaceous border or a cottage garden.
